Ripple (XRP) Overview

Ripple is a cryptocurrency and a digital payment protocol designed for fast and low-cost international money transfers. 

Unlike other cryptocurrencies, Ripple's primary focus is facilitating seamless cross-border transactions for financial institutions. Its native digital asset, XRP, acts as a bridge currency for transferring value between different fiat currencies.

Historical Performance of Ripple (XRP)

XRP has experienced both significant highs and lows throughout its existence. In early 2018, when the cryptocurrency market was in a state of euphoria, XRP reached its all-time high of $3.84. At that time, its market capitalization stood at $139.4 billion, accounting for 20% of the entire crypto market.

However, regulatory challenges and negative sentiment surrounding XRP led to a substantial price retracement. Currently, XRP is trading at around $0.50, a significant drop from its ATH. The current market capitalization of XRP is $26.29 billion, representing around 2.5% of the total crypto market capitalization.

Ripple (XRP) Current Fundamentals

Despite the price volatility, Ripple (XRP) has established strong partnerships and collaborations within the financial industry. It has joined forces with companies like Mastercard, Bank of America, and central banks worldwide. These partnerships demonstrate the potential for XRP to play a significant role in the global financial ecosystem.

Moreover, XRP has a decentralized circulating supply, with the top 10 addresses holding only 10.7% of the total supply. This decentralization sets XRP apart from other cryptocurrencies like Dogecoin and Ethereum, where a small number of addresses control a significant portion of the circulating supply.

Can XRP Reach 500 Dollars?

No, Considering current market conditions and XRP fundamentals, it's nearly impossible to reach $500, but still, it's a topic of debate among analysts and traders. While it is theoretically possible, several factors make this price target highly unlikely soon.

To reach $500, XRP's price would need to increase by approximately 100,000% from its current price of $0.50. This would result in a market capitalization of over $26 trillion, surpassing the combined value of the four largest public companies in the world - Apple, Microsoft, Saudi Aramco, and Alphabet.

While XRP has demonstrated its potential for growth in the past, achieving such a high price target would require unprecedented market adoption and widespread usage of XRP in global financial transactions.

Smart contracts have revolutionized blockchain technology, automating transactions and agreements without intermediaries. However, a single bug in a smart contract can lead to catastrophic financial losses, as demonstrated by numerous high-profile hacks in the crypto space. Testing smart contracts isn't just good practice—it's absolutely essential for protecting users and maintaining trust in decentralized systems.

Understanding Smart Contract Testing

Smart contracts are self-executing programs deployed on blockchains like Ethereum, Binance Smart Chain, and Solana. Unlike traditional software, once deployed, they're immutable—you can't patch bugs with a simple update. This permanence makes comprehensive testing critical before deployment.

Testing smart contracts involves verifying that the code performs exactly as intended under all possible conditions, including edge cases and potential attack vectors. The stakes are incredibly high: vulnerabilities have resulted in losses exceeding billions of dollars across the cryptocurrency ecosystem.

Types of Smart Contract Testing

Unit Testing

Unit testing forms the foundation of smart contract security. Developers write tests for individual functions and components, verifying that each piece works correctly in isolation. Frameworks like Hardhat, Truffle, and Foundry provide robust environments for writing and executing unit tests.

These tests should cover normal operations, boundary conditions, and expected failures. For instance, if your contract has a withdrawal function, unit tests should verify successful withdrawals, rejection of unauthorized attempts, and proper handling of insufficient balances.

Integration Testing

While unit tests examine individual components, integration testing verifies how different parts of your smart contract work together. This includes testing interactions between multiple contracts, ensuring that complex workflows execute correctly from start to finish.

Integration tests reveal issues that might not appear in isolated unit tests, such as unexpected state changes, gas limit problems, or incorrect event emissions when multiple functions execute in sequence.

Functional Testing

Functional testing validates that your smart contract meets its specified requirements and business logic. This involves testing complete user scenarios and workflows to ensure the contract behaves as stakeholders expect.

For example, if you're building a decentralized exchange, functional testing would verify the entire trading process: connecting wallets, approving tokens, executing swaps, and updating balances correctly.

Advanced Testing Methodologies

Fuzz Testing

Fuzz testing automatically generates random or semi-random inputs to discover unexpected behaviors and edge cases that manual testing might miss. Tools like Echidna and Foundry's fuzzing capabilities can test thousands of scenarios quickly, uncovering vulnerabilities that human testers might overlook.

This approach is particularly valuable for finding integer overflow issues, reentrancy vulnerabilities, and other subtle bugs that emerge only under specific conditions.

Static Analysis

Static analysis tools examine smart contract code without executing it, identifying potential vulnerabilities, code smells, and deviations from best practices. Popular tools include Slither, Mythril, and Securify, each offering different strengths in vulnerability detection.

These tools can catch common issues like unchecked external calls, improper access controls, and dangerous delegatecall usage before the code ever runs on a blockchain.

Formal Verification

Formal verification represents the gold standard in smart contract security. This mathematical approach proves that a contract's code correctly implements its specifications under all possible conditions. While resource-intensive, formal verification provides the highest level of assurance.

Projects handling significant value increasingly employ formal verification for critical components, especially in DeFi protocols where mathematical precision is paramount.

Testing Best Practices

Test Coverage

Aim for comprehensive test coverage, ideally exceeding 90% of your codebase. However, coverage percentage alone doesn't guarantee security—focus on testing critical paths, edge cases, and potential attack vectors thoroughly.

Automated Testing Pipelines

Implement continuous integration and continuous deployment (CI/CD) pipelines that automatically run your test suite whenever code changes. This catches regressions early and ensures that new features don't introduce vulnerabilities.

Testnet Deployment

Before mainnet deployment, thoroughly test your contracts on testnets like Goerli, Sepolia, or Mumbai. Testnet deployment provides real-world conditions without risking actual funds, allowing you to identify issues with gas optimization, network interactions, and user experience.

Security Audits

Professional security audits from reputable firms provide an independent assessment of your smart contract's security. Auditors bring specialized expertise and fresh perspectives that internal teams might lack. Consider multiple audits for high-value contracts.

Testing Tools and Frameworks

Modern developers have access to powerful testing frameworks. Hardhat offers a comprehensive development environment with excellent testing capabilities and debugging tools. Foundry provides extremely fast testing written in Solidity itself, while Brownie serves Python developers with familiar syntax and powerful features.

Each framework has strengths: Hardhat excels in JavaScript/TypeScript environments, Foundry offers unmatched performance, and Brownie integrates beautifully with Python-based workflows.

Common Testing Pitfalls

Avoid testing only happy paths—attackers target edge cases and unexpected inputs. Don't neglect gas optimization testing, as inefficient contracts frustrate users and waste funds. Remember that testnet conditions differ from mainnet, particularly regarding network congestion and MEV considerations.
